## Summary
Enhances the error panel with node-specific views: single-node selection
shows errors grouped by message in compact mode, container nodes
(subgraph/group) expose child errors via a badge and "See Error" button,
and a floating ErrorOverlay appears after execution failure with a
deduplicated summary and quick navigation to the errors tab.

## Changes
- **Consolidate error tab**: Remove `TabError.vue`; merge all error
display into `TabErrors.vue` and drop the separate `error` tab type from
`rightSidePanelStore`
- **Selection-aware grouping**: Single-node selection regroups errors by
message (not `class_type`) and renders `ErrorNodeCard` in compact mode
- **Container node support**: Detect child-node errors in subgraph/group
nodes via execution ID prefix matching; show error badge and "See Error"
button in `SectionWidgets`
- **ErrorOverlay**: New floating card shown after execution failure with
deduplicated error messages, "Dismiss" and "See Errors" actions;
`isErrorOverlayOpen` / `showErrorOverlay` / `dismissErrorOverlay` added
to `executionStore`
- **Refactor**: Centralize error ID collection in `executionStore`
(`allErrorExecutionIds`, `hasInternalErrorForNode`); split `errorGroups`
into `allErrorGroups` (unfiltered) and `tabErrorGroups`
(selection-filtered); move `ErrorOverlay` business logic into
`useErrorGroups`

## Review Focus
- `useErrorGroups.ts`: split into `allErrorGroups` / `tabErrorGroups`
and the new `filterBySelection` parameter flow
- `executionStore.ts`: `hasInternalErrorForNode` helper and
`allErrorExecutionIds` computed
- `ErrorOverlay.vue`: integration with `executionStore` overlay state
and `useErrorGroups`
